Unmanaged Gigabit Ethernet Switch Product Analysis
Unmanaged Gigabit Ethernet switches are characterized by their simplicity, cost-effectiveness, and plug-and-play functionality, making them ideal for basic networking needs. Product innovations primarily focus on enhancing energy efficiency, improving port density in compact form factors, and ensuring robust reliability for consistent performance. Their key application lies in providing high-speed wired connectivity for homes, small offices, and branch locations, supporting devices such as computers, printers, network-attached storage (NAS), and IP cameras. Competitive advantages stem from their ease of deployment, minimal configuration requirements, and significantly lower total cost of ownership compared to managed switches. Market fit is exceptionally strong for users prioritizing straightforward network expansion without the complexity of advanced management features.
Key Drivers, Barriers & Challenges in Unmanaged Gigabit Ethernet Switch
The Unmanaged Gigabit Ethernet Switch market is propelled by several key drivers, including the ever-increasing demand for faster internet speeds and the proliferation of connected devices in both residential and business environments. The growing adoption of IoT devices, smart home technologies, and the continuous need for reliable home office connectivity are significant technological and consumer-driven factors. Economically, the affordability and cost-effectiveness of unmanaged Gigabit switches make them an attractive option for a broad user base. Policy-driven factors, such as government initiatives promoting broadband expansion and digitalization, indirectly support market growth.
Conversely, the market faces several barriers and challenges. While unmanaged switches are simple, the lack of advanced features can be a restraint for larger or more complex networks requiring VLANs, QoS, or remote management, pushing users towards more expensive managed solutions. Supply chain disruptions, though gradually easing, can still impact raw material availability and lead times, potentially affecting pricing and product availability. Intense competitive pressure among manufacturers leads to price wars, squeezing profit margins. Furthermore, the increasing sophistication of wireless networking technologies, while not a direct substitute, can sometimes fulfill basic connectivity needs for certain users, potentially limiting the growth of very low-port-count unmanaged switches.
